Hair Perm – Home Perm Hair Style by Jerry White

Friday, October 16th, 2009

Making straight hair curly is not a new hair style idea. Women in ancient Egypt coated their hair in mud, wound it around wooden rods and then used the heat from the sun to create the curls. Waves that won’t wash out are a more recent innovation. Modern perms were pioneered by A F Willat, who invented the “cold permanent wave” technique in 1934.
